Requirements
In this section you'll find various information about requirements and scope of the project.
Functional requirements
3D models
- User must be able to import models into the system. (FBX, STL, VTK, other formats tbc.)
- User must be able to project imported models in 3D space using HoloLens.
- User must be able to move, rotate and scale projected 3D models.
- User must be able to expand projected model
- User must be able to change colour and transparency of various parts of the model after it has been exploded
- User must be able to view multiple models at the same time.
DICOM images
- User must be able to import DICOM images into the system.
- User must be able to project and register (lock in some position) DICOM images in 3D space.
- User must be able to move, rotate and scale DICOM images.
- User must be able to scroll through projected DICOM images.
- User will be able to view multiple DICOM images at the same time.
Data markers
- User must be able to place and remove data markers on models and DICOM images
- User must be able to add voice recordings to markers
- User must be able to add text notes to markers